10/2/2014 Update
So started the install on all the parts I purchased for my Mazdaspeed6. Here is the list of things i got... - Corksport 4pot Big Brake Caliper Attachment 637510 - Stoptech Slotted Brakes Attachment 637511 - H&R Coilovers Attachment 637512 - SPC Adjustable Ball Joint Attachment 637513 So the first day of work was halted by one main factor... i did purchase the mazdaspeed6 in Oregon and a lot of the fasteners were seized. Mainly the 17mm bolt that holds the front brake bracket , the 17mm bolt that holds the rear brakes and the stupid Philips head fasteners that hold the brake rotor to the hub. With the help of WD-40 and another penetrating liquid (can't remember the name) and time, i was able to use a mallet with a wrench to brake the 17mm bolts free but those darn Philips heads... Here's a picture of the front brake bracket while waiting on the penetrating liquid to settle in. Attachment 637514 Some pictures after fully removing the brakes... and also those philip heads... Attachment 637515 Attachment 637516 I was able to use a step bit with my drill to drill the philips head off finally loosening the rotors! Yay! Trust me, i tried everything.. wish i had an impact driver at this time.. Well, after removing everything, i had to clean the rusty hub and cleaned my rear calipers and prepped them for painting to try to match the front. Originally Posted by Ka Kui
(Post 12105002)
Is your Spirit R CD head unit a direct plug & play? I notice your CW FD3S is a base model. I have the stock BOSE system, and also want to change to a 99 spec head unit.
- Steel support beam/bracket behind the head unit needs to be cut (if LHD) - Frequency Amplifier did not work for me (still looking in to that) so can't get any station above 85.0 - If you're LHD, volume knob is on the right instead of the left. The first item was the only hurdle really. I have the 6-CD Disc changer and the aux module so i usually just have my spotify or CD's on. The HU was made for the bose system so you'll make the most out of it :) Quick Update BBS wheels were supposed to get mounted on last week, only problem was that they did not come with Valve Stems and the Valve Stems for the wheels are smaller and a bit more unique. Almost forgot that this existed! Sorry about that! Haven't done anything much to the FD, just getting a bunch of parts in now. The newest thing that the FD has is the Mazsdaspeed CF Intake finally! Thanks @Ka Kui for sourcing this for me. It took a lot of patience and money but Chris was able to source it for me and get it to the states.
https://cimg3.ibsrv.net/gimg/www.rx7...6ef444485f.jpg I was able to maintain everything but had to reroute the front airbag wire. Instead of going from above, i rerouted it under the CF box and just got it to above the rebar. Luckily there was a lot of slack on that wire. Because there was no DIY instructions for this piece, i had to go slow and had issues where the CF box did come in to contact with the frame. Found out that keeping the filter in the box is not a good idea (du'h). Will post more updates accordingly. Got some updates on the rx8 and will take some pictures of it as well. |
